Ticket: Expired credentials blocking fan-out drain on Pulsewick Notify. Since the signer cert lapsed, the fan-out workers cannot authenticate to the queue broker, so backpressure has pushed notification lag past 40 minutes. Please rotate the worker credential before restarting consumers, and drain the backlog in batches of 500 to avoid another spike. Use the replacement key issued below for the broker service.

service key, fawip-bajef: kto11_Qt5wZK9vdNC

Handing over the Cartwheel driver-assignment heuristic. Plugin authors can override the scoring function, but note the base weights (distance, idle time, rejection history) are normalized before your hook runs, so return values in the 0–1 range. Fleet-wide overrides require the Ostermill capability flag. Marta left thorough inline docs. The extension contract and scoring reference are published on this page.

operations page: https://jenkins.zemvarcloud.local/job/merge_requests/repo/build/73930b4b30f0a8ed

- [ ] **Checkout load test sign-off.** New folks: before any release of the Tillhouse checkout, run the standard 30-minute ramp against the staging gateway and confirm p95 latency stays under budget with no failed payments in the synthetic ledger. Record the results in the perf log and get a second reviewer to acknowledge. The load run must be executed against the build listed below.

pipeline stamp: htk31_f769b577b3028a4e9958e5bb8d1259a

Ticket: Vault lockout blocking cold-start tuning — Lanternfly functions

The Lanternfly team's secrets vault auto-locked after three failed unlock attempts, and the cold-start tuning job for our serverless handlers can't fetch its warmup config. Until it's unlocked, handlers cold-start with default memory settings, which adds roughly 400ms of latency. New team members: don't retry the unlock manually. The on-call runbook says to restore access using the recovery passphrase recorded below.

vault phrase of bafop-kahop = sormir-frador